I have a 2007 apex ER I had a track blow out today it took out the front heat exchanger and exhaust and idler wheels :o| so I need a track and wheels and heat exchanger. I have the opertunity to change it to a 136 instead of a 121 at a good deal what do you guys think ???

136" is a big difference in the way it handles the bumps,a lot better. You will probably lose a few mph on the top end and you will notice a huge difference in cornering. Its a bear in the tight corners. I can keep up with anyone on a 121" but it takes more muscle to turn it. I love my 136"
